1. Defense Evasion & Zero-Day Endpoint Exploitation
Adversaries are actively bypassing and inverting endpoint security controls, using trusted EDR signatures and components as Trojan horses to bypass Windows Protected Process Light (PPL).
- ShieldBreak Zero-Day (Defender Patch Bypass) — A functional zero-day PoC named ShieldBreak completely bypasses Microsoft's incomplete August 2026 patch for CVE-2026-50656 (RoguePlanet). By exploiting unpatched thread-lock synchronization and memory pointer leaks in
mpengine.dll, local low-privileged users can instantly elevate to SYSTEM privileges and completely blind Microsoft Defender. - "Bring Your Own EDR" (BYOEDR) — Local administrators are abusing legitimate, signed SentinelOne Agents via an unvalidated COM interface (
SentinelHelper.1). Attackers can dump protected antimalware memory, extract COM secrets, and inject unsigned code into PPL-protected processes. Furthermore, they can use the EDR's own file tamper protection features to shield malicious payloads from manual termination. - Cisco ClamAV & Secure Endpoint DoS — Multiple high-severity vulnerabilities (such as CVE-2026-20337 and CVE-2026-20338) in ClamAV's file format parsers allow unauthenticated, remote attackers to trigger out-of-bounds writes or double-free memory corruption. By submitting specially crafted ZIP or PDF files for scanning, attackers can crash the scanning engine, creating a Denial of Service state that disables Cisco Secure Endpoint protection.
2. Edge Perimeter Collapse & Ransomware
The enterprise perimeter is under severe strain from automated credential harvesting and high-severity vulnerabilities targeting edge routing, secure gateways, and virtualization platforms.
- Gunra Ransomware Exploiting Fortinet VPNs — Gunra threat actors are actively exploiting critical authentication bypass vulnerabilities in internet-facing Fortinet VPNs (CVE-2024-55591 and CVE-2025-24472). Upon gaining super-admin privileges, attackers tamper with virtual desktop infrastructure (VDI) authentication portals to hardcode OTP values (bypassing MFA), extract NTDS hashes, and deploy cross-platform encryption payloads.
- Systemic Fortinet Ecosystem Vulnerabilities — Fortinet addressed multiple severe vulnerabilities across its suite. Most critically, CVE-2026-26035 allows an unauthenticated remote attacker to bypass administrative authentication on FortiWeb appliances configured with wildcard Remote RADIUS authentication. Additionally, a kernel driver heap overflow in FortiClient (CVE-2026-70465) poses severe operational risks.
- Zoom "Zoomsday" RCE & VMware vCenter Flaws — A critical zero-click memory corruption flaw (CVE-2026-53413/4/5) in Zoom's proprietary annotation protocol (
libannotate.so) allows attackers to execute arbitrary code on all meeting participants without user interaction. Concurrently, a directory traversal flaw in VMware vCenter Server (CVE-2026-59310) is undergoing active mass exploitation globally, allowing attackers to drop malicious cron jobs for persistence.
3. Enterprise Application & Infrastructure Privilege Escalation
Vulnerabilities deep within enterprise collaboration servers, Kubernetes orchestration, and legacy network peripherals are providing attackers with silent pathways to full domain control.
- Microsoft Exchange Server Critical RCE — Microsoft's Patch Tuesday addressed six key vulnerabilities in on-premises Exchange Servers. Most notably, CVE-2026-62913 (CVSS 8.8) is a network-accessible heap-based buffer overflow allowing unauthenticated RCE. Additionally, an authentication bypass via capture-replay (CVE-2026-62911) was publicly demonstrated at Pwn2Own, enabling unauthorized mailbox exfiltration.
- Red Hat ACM Privilege Escalation (CVE-2026-10090) — A critical flaw in Red Hat Advanced Cluster Management (ACM) allows an authenticated attacker with basic namespace-scoped edit permissions to bypass intent-based authorization controls. By deploying a custom Helm chart via the Application Subscription controller, attackers can force the creation of cluster-scoped resources (like
ClusterRoleBinding) to escalate to fullcluster-admin. - IoT Printers as Active Directory Pivots — Threat actors are actively exploiting unpatched IoT printers using default credentials. Once compromised, the printers' cleartext "Scan-to-Email" LDAP configurations are harvested, or the MS-RPRN Print Spooler interface is abused to coerce domain controller authentication, enabling Pass-the-Hash and DCSync attacks against Tier-0 AD infrastructure.
- Linux Kernel Network Scheduler LPE (CVE-2026-68138) — A race condition in the Linux kernel’s
net/schedtraffic control scheduler allows unprivileged local users to trigger a Use-After-Free condition via concurrent flower filter network requests, leading to kernel memory corruption or local Denial of Service.
Proactive Steps for the Week
- Harden Endpoint Detection and Response (EDR): Implement strict Least Privilege Access (LPA) to ensure standard users cannot weaponize
mpengine.dllusing the ShieldBreak zero-day exploit. Upgrade all SentinelOne Windows Agents to version 26.1.1+ to patch the unvalidated COM interface vulnerability. - Apply Edge & Virtualization Patches: Upgrade exposed FortiOS and FortiProxy units to fixed releases (e.g., FortiOS 7.0.17+, 7.2.7+) to resolve the active Gunra ransomware vectors. Deploy Zoom Workplace clients version 7.1.5 (or VDI version 7.0.11) to eliminate the zero-click "Zoomsday" RCE vector, and patch VMware vCenter (CVE-2026-59310) immediately.
- Secure Microsoft Exchange & Red Hat ACM: Deploy the August Microsoft Exchange Security Updates across all on-premises instances and verify the installation using the Exchange Health Checker. For Red Hat ACM hubs, strictly restrict namespace edit privileges to trusted administrators until CVE-2026-10090 errata are applied.
- Isolate Network Peripherals & Disable Print Spooler: Place all IoT printers on a dedicated, restricted VLAN. Disable the Print Spooler service (
spoolsv.exe) on all Domain Controllers to prevent authentication coercion attacks (MS-RPRN), and mandate LDAPS for all directory integrations. - Restrict Traffic Control & Network Namespaces: To mitigate the Linux Kernel
net/schedflaw (CVE-2026-68138), restrict raw netlink capabilities to trusted administrators and disable unprivileged user namespace cloning (sysctl -w kernel.unprivileged_userns_clone=0) until vendor kernel patches are applied.
